Easy Chicken Lo Mein

  • Total Time: 30 mins
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Description

Easy Chicken Lo Mein is a flavorful, one-pan noodle dish that comes together in under 30 minutes. Tender chicken, crisp vegetables, and soft lo mein noodles are tossed in a savory soy-ginger sauce for a quick weeknight dinner.


Ingredients

Scale

2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, thinly sliced

8 oz lo mein noodles or spaghetti

2 tablespoons vegetable oil

1 red bell pepper, sliced

1 cup broccoli florets

2 carrots, julienned

3 cloves garlic, minced

2 teaspoons fresh ginger, minced

1/4 cup soy sauce

2 tablespoons oyster sauce

1 tablespoon hoisin sauce

1 teaspoon sesame oil

2 green onions, sliced

1 tablespoon cornstarch mixed with 2 tablespoons water (optional)


Instructions

1. Cook lo mein noodles according to package directions, drain, and set aside.

2.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at.

3. Add chicken slices and cook until lightly browned and cooked through, about 5–6 minutes. Remove chicken and set aside.

4. In the same skillet, add garlic and ginger, sauté for 30 seconds until fragrant.

5. Add bell pepper, broccoli, and carrots, stir-frying 3–4 minutes until vegetables are crisp-tender.

6. Return chicken to the skillet and add cooked noodles. Toss to combine.

7. In a small bowl, mix soy sauce, oyster sauce, hoisin sauce, and sesame oil. Pour over the chicken and noodles, tossing to coat evenly.

8. If a thicker sauce is desired, add cornstarch slurry and cook 1–2 minutes until sauce thickens.

9. Garnish with sliced green onions and serve hot.

Notes

Swap vegetables according to preference.

Use shrimp, beef, or tofu instead of chicken.

Add sesame seeds for extra flavor.

Prepare sauce in advance for quick assembly.
